The reason Portland is such an environmental nirvana is that heavy industry and employers generally are fleeing to adjacent counties. US 26, the ‘Sunset Highway,’ linking Portland to Washington County, is now congested -outbound- in the mornings and -inbound- in the evenings. Mass transit ridership (run by a tri-county authority) is inflated by counting ‘boardings’ instead of modeling commuting patterns (bus to transit station, light rail to 2nd transit station, bus to work, is three trips). And the real howler is the one about easing traffic congestion. The C of P is openly hostile to sensible traffic accommodation. Congestion is a planning goal. Inadequate parking for new projects is mandated by zoning codes. Complain, and the answer is, Ride the Bus.
